About Santa Rosa Historical Society
The Santa Rosa Historical Society, located in Milton, FL, is a local organization dedicated to studying and preserving the history of Milton. The Historical Society fosters an appreciation of the past, with an emphasis on local history. In addition to collecting and preserving historical artifacts, photographs, and personal stories, the Historical Society conducts research into local Santa Rosa County families and businesses, which they present to the public through exhibits. The Historical Society also provides public historical records.
